SOUTH-CENTRAL, Ind. - The National Weather Service (NWS) issued a Severe Thunderstorm Warning for Bartholomew, Johnson and other South-Central Indiana counties on Wednesday Morning, March 11 until 9:45 a.m.
Counties affected include:
Northern Bartholomew County in central Indiana... Hancock County in central Indiana... Shelby County in central Indiana... Rush County in central Indiana... Decatur County in central Indiana... Northeastern Brown County in south central Indiana... Johnson County in central Indiana...Southern Henry County in east central Indiana... Southeastern Marion County in central Indiana...
At 851 AM EDT, severe thunderstorms were located along a line extending from near Southport to near Nashville, moving east at 70 mph.
HAZARD...60 mph wind gusts.
SOURCE...Radar indicated.
IMPACT...Expect damage to roofs, siding, and trees.
* Locations impacted include... Indianapolis, Columbus, Shelbyville, Greenwood, Franklin, Greenfield, New Castle, Beech Grove, Greensburg, Rushville, Southport, Nashville, Adams, New Whiteland, Cumberland, Edinburgh, Whiteland, Bargersville, Knightstown, and Hope.
This includes the following highways... Interstate 65 between mile markers 68 and 111. Interstate 70 near mile marker 80, and between mile markers 89 and 133. Interstate 74 between mile markers 93 and 144.
